Sewa TT Blood Drives commenced in 2007 due to the difficulties faced by Thalassemic patients for regular supply of blood for transfusions. Since 2007 Sewa TT has successfully completed thirty one (31) blood drives in collaboration with the Friends of the Blood Bank Association and have inspired and assisted many other organisations to conduct blood drives. In the event of a natural disaster, Sewa TT now has a pool of donors that can be called upon to donate blood and a network of organisations that have the know-how to run efficient blood drives.
Objectives of Blood Drives:
To Increase the National Supply of Blood
To promote safe, non-remunerated, voluntary blood donation
To facilitate a nation-building process that allows people to serve their fellow citizens through a process that does not discriminate
To eliminate negative myths of blood donation
To create a comfortable atmosphere for family and friends to donate together
